Why ceramic, and not just any tint

All window videos should not the equal. Dyed movie darkens the glass, which will help with privacy, but it does little opposed to radiant warmth and it fades sooner, particularly with salty winter dirt and cruel spring cleansing. Metallized movie rejects extra warm, yet it might probably intrude with electronics, radio indications, and onboard telematics. That is fine on a basic coupe, no longer so exceptional on a related fleet van going for walks dispatch pills and hotspots.

Ceramic movie works in a different way. It is made with nano-ceramic particles that target the infrared spectrum, the a part of daylight that includes heat. A brilliant ceramic film blocks up to 99 p.c of UV and rejects a considerable share of infrared warm, generally inside the 80 to 95 % vary depending on the exact product and measured wavelength band. In apply, meaning a cabin that beneficial properties warmness greater slowly at a stoplight and cools quicker once the A/C engages returned. The radio reads clear, so does the GPS and cell modem. And the film keeps its impartial coloration with no turning crimson or hazy after some years of Chicago seasons.

On a work truck, neutrality concerns. You do no longer desire the glass to study dark blue at one perspective and bronze at an alternative while a patron enables you to right into a dock. You would like a pointy, factory-adjoining look that doesn't draw attention yet cuts the glare.

What the rules allows in Illinois, with a fleet lens

Regulations evolve, so that you should always consistently ascertain with the Illinois statute and your fleet compliance lead. Here is the working fact many stores persist with as of new years:

    Front side home windows on maximum trucks will have to enable a sizable amount of mild, in many instances interpreted as round 35 p.c. noticeable easy transmission or superior. For vans, SUVs, and a lot of paintings vehicles, rear edge windows and the rear window can most of the time be darker than the front sides, most often down to manufacturing facility privacy tiers or darker, provided the the front home windows remain compliant. The windshield can take delivery of a non reflective sun strip above the AS-1 line. Full windshield tint is broadly speaking not authorised other than scientific exemptions and genuine clean motion pictures that block UV without altering visual pale.

Because business trucks differ commonly in category, distinctly once they begin as passenger vehicles and get converted, it's good to spec conservatively on the front door glass and allow the rear cabin carry the privacy load. Most legit installers who control fleets in Chicago will construct a bundle that keeps you at the correct edge of nearby enforcement when meeting your thermal pursuits.

Thermal load, idle time, and prices you unquestionably feel

If you possess 5 to twenty trucks and vans, you pay for warmth two times. First in driving force relief and productivity, then in gasoline and preservation. Urban routes end usually, meaning cycling the A/C hard. A prime high-quality ceramic film reduces cabin heat profit at every one stop, so the compressor does no longer need to claw lower back as many ranges on every pullout. Spread that performance across a season and it provides up.

Here is a conservative way to check out it. On a well-known delivery van with vast glass, ceramic movie can trim cabin temperature rises by way of quite a few degrees in keeping with quit. That modest delta repeatedly translates into the A/C attaining a cosy setpoint swifter and cycling off sooner. Fleet managers I paintings with report a small however regular gasoline merit inside the 1 to three % number for decent-season urban routes, which comports with the physics. That shouldn't be a miracle quantity, however across lots of metropolis miles and dozens of cars, it could possibly duvet the check of the movie within the first couple of years whilst also chopping driver court cases.

There is a repairs angle too. Running the A/C much less aggressively can ease wear at the compressor and belts. You would possibly not note it in a unmarried van, but on a 40 automobile roster, even mild upgrades guide flatten the spend curve.

Choosing the precise visual gentle point by means of use case

Two trucks can want other specs, notwithstanding they proportion a badge. Think in terms of routes and hours. Daytime carrier trucks that infrequently function at evening can elevate a darker cargo house film without downside. Vehicles that run past due deliveries may want to hinder rear home windows quite lighter to resource mirror visibility in rain. If your drivers use backup cameras heavily, make certain the digital camera’s low faded overall performance in the past you settle upon a truly dark rear window movie. A darker movie can coax cameras into boosting advantage, which will increase noise in moist conditions.

The entrance doors deserve targeted attention. Compliance comes first. After that, go with a ceramic with excessive infrared rejection even at a lighter seen tint. Many good tier ceramics give effective warm keep an eye on at legal front door sun shades. That retains officers completely satisfied in the time of a roadside interaction and retains drivers satisfied all afternoon.

Winter care and longevity

Chicago winters do no longer kill ceramic movie, careless scraping does. I have watched drivers take a metallic edged scraper to the within of a fogged window at a task site. You can guess the results. Supply silicone edged squeegees in every van. Train groups to apply them on indoors condensation and to let defrost do its paintings on exterior frost. The film is scratch resistant, now not scratch proof. Road salt and grit trapped in window felt can act like sandpaper every time a window drops. During winter, encourage drivers to restriction window operation for the 1st few days after a refreshing installation, and to wipe the inner felt channel with a moist microfiber once a month. It takes one minute and spares the edges.

Washing is unassuming. A light cleaning soap answer and a cushy towel paintings. Avoid ammonia cleaners, which may haze plastics and seals besides the fact that they do not without delay harm exceptional motion pictures. Avoid prime strain direct blasts at window edges in the first week after install, peculiarly in cold temps.

Commercial structures and the small quirks that matter

Sprinter. Tall door glass and a low beltline make glare control substantial. Ensure a top cut down at the entrance door movie to suit the glass curve, or you can still see hands by using the second iciness. Door seals carry grit, so ask the shop to clear felts thoroughly.

Transit. The windshield is beneficiant and the A-pillars are chunky. A easy, felony ceramic strip at the suitable of the windshield can tame afternoon sun devoid of drawing interest, presented it sits above the AS-1 line. The sliding door glass, if fitted, reward from a moderately lighter coloration for side visibility at evening.

ProMaster. The door glass has a more vertical profile. It is straightforward to rush and depart a bit of of water near the cut back mirror mounting location. That water will workout, yet an efficient hand will squeegee deep and wipe channels so the healing is uniform.

Box vans and cutaways. You quite often have best front doors and a windshield to deal with, which puts a top class on deciding upon a ceramic that does plenty of thermal paintings in a felony colour. Keep bureaucracy displaying the film’s specs inside the cab binder, highly for interstate paintings.
